Asian PVC: Prices rise $10/mt due to China's positive sentiment / Initial Oct offers settled with rollover / Local China price increases Yuan 200 to 550/mt - Oct 04, 2024

Oct 04, 2024

The price of Asian polyvinyl chloride increased by $10/mt from last week to $760/mt CFR China on Oct. 2. This was due to a more positive sentiment that developed earlier in the week following China's stimulus announcement. The market sentiment in China firmed up earlier this week, before the October Golden Week holiday. This was due to the latest stimulus package that pushed China's futures and stock markets higher. According to exchange data, January PVC futures at the Dalian Commodity Exchange increased Yuan 267/mt from day to day to Yuan 5,799/mt on Sep. 30. China's Golden Week holiday begun Oct. 1.
